Microsoft recently purchased a Master Data Management vendor Stratature. After I looked at their web site, I guess that Stratature’s offerings seems falling into the BI related MDM , like what Oracle – Hyperion’s product. Their webinar is co-presented with Joy Mundy from the Kimbal Group.
Stratature provides the “Dimension Manager” as the solution for Customer Data Integration. Based on the name of the product, we can also know their solution is BI centric.

Master Data Management is a combination of business processes, software application, and technologies which helps you to manage your master data, such as “Customer”, “Supplier”, “Employee”, and “Product”.
